The second GTA VI trailer showed a small detail thanks to which players saw a hint of future additions
Rockstar Games unexpectedly released the second trailer for Grand Theft Auto 6, which instantly captivated fans and garnered hundreds of millions of views. The video reveals new plot details, introduces the main characters, and players have already found hints of large-scale plans for the game world.
Here's What We Know
Particular interest was aroused by the details that, at first glance, seem to be trifles, but may indicate future locations in the game or add-ons. One of the shots shows car licence plates from fictional states - Gloriana (reminiscent of Georgia), Arizona, and the iconic Liberty City. This gave rise to several versions: these are Easter eggs or a hint of the expansion of the GTA 6 world in the form of DLC in the future.
Players on social media recalled that back in 2020, journalist Jason Schreier reported on Rockstar's plans to release the game with regular updates that would expand the world. Therefore, the appearance of different number plates may be the first signal of large-scale DLC or even future sequels.
Rockstar has officially confirmed that the release of GTA 6 has been postponed until 26 May 2026 to ensure the highest quality of the game. Fans' expectations are high, as the previous part of GTA 5 has sold over 200 million copies.
